WebDec 10, 2012 · A new report by Deloitte finds that mobile phones have a measurable impact on economic growth. The study’s authors demonstrate that for every 10% shift in American markets from 2G to 3G between 2008 and 2011, per capita GDP increased by 0.4%. WebFeb 24, 2024 · A phone’s birth is the most contaminating part of its life cycle: around 80% of each device’s carbon footprint is generated at the manufacturing stage. This is due to the mining, refining, transport and assembly of the dozens of chemical elements that make up cutting-edge tech: iron for the speakers and microphones, aluminium and magnesium ...
